基于MSP430G2231的万用表设计.docxVIP

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
?摘要 本设计基于MSP430G2231为核心控制系统,结合适量的硬件设计,配合12864液晶,制作出一个自动量程的电压,电阻,温度测试仪表。电压量程在0-11V,电阻档量程:0-100kΩ,温度适于室温测量。此表多适用于/电子DIY爱好者使用。一:简介万用表作被誉为电子爱好者的手术刀,在我们进行电子设计时占据举足轻重的作用。所以拥有一个属于自己的万用表是每一个设计者的心愿,不求多复杂,能两个电压,测个电阻就行。/forum.php?mod=attachmentaid=OTg0Njd8NWU1NGQ1MTR8MTUxMTE2OTM3MXwwfDI0MjM2Nw%3D%3Dnothumb=yesjavascript:;二:测量原理1. 电压测量:/forum.php?mod=attachmentaid=OTg0Njh8YTRkN2JhMmF8MTUxMTE2OTM3MXwwfDI0MjM2Nw%3D%3Dnothumb=yesjavascript:;当被测电压VDD时,由上图可知,我们只需测出V值,即可知道VDD值。VDD=V*(R9+R10)/R10.而V的值可用430的ADC采集得到。2. 电阻测量:/forum.php?mod=attachmentaid=OTg0Njl8NzBlYjUyNTB8MTUxMTE2OTM3MXwwfDI0MjM2Nw%3D%3Dnothumb=yesjavascript:; 原理和电压测量一样当VDD已知,R10已知,V已知时。R9的阻值:R9=(VDD/V-1)*R10。3:温度测量:基于18B20。DS1820 数字温度计以9 位数字量的形式反映器件的温度值。DS1820 通过一个单线接口发送或接收信息,因此在中央微处理器和DS1820 之间仅需一条连接线(加上地线)。用于读写和温度转换的/zhuti_power_1.html电源可以从数据线本身获得,无需外部电源。因为每个 DS1820 都有一个独特的片序列号,所以多只DS1820 可以同时连在一根单线总线上,这样就可以把温度传感器放在许多不同的地方。这一特性在HVAC 环境控制、探测建筑物、仪器或机器的温度以及过程监测和控制等方面非常有用。整体设计思路三:/zhuti_dianlu_1.html电路实现1:电阻与电压测量外围硬件电路图,电压测量时,高电位端接红表笔,低电位端接黑表笔。通过运放的电压跟随,解决了数字万用表仅使用于测量恒压源的窘境,但同时也由于运放的限制,测量电压范围变小。当测量电压低于2V时,ADC0采集的电压值有效,作为测量值,而ADC1采样无效。每次测量都是由大量程开始,通过程序判断,该量程是否合适,如量程太大,进行小量程切换。2:电阻的测量是本设计的经典,不借助于模拟开关,手动开关选档。而借助于/zhuti_mcu_1.html单片机IO口的上拉输出,高阻态输入完成自动选档。如当P12为高电平时,P13为高阻态时,R5与被测电阻形成通路分IO口电压,然后再经358跟随供AD采集。通过切换P12,P13的输入输出状态即可实现档位切换。2: /forum.php?mod=attachmentaid=OTg0NzB8OGI3YTUwY2F8MTUxMTE2OTM3MXwwfDI0MjM2Nw%3D%3Dnothumb=yesjavascript:; /forum.php?mod=attachmentaid=OTg0NzF8YzQ1N2VmM2Z8MTUxMTE2OTM3MXwwfDI0MjM2Nw%3D%3Dnothumb=yesjavascript:;18B20具有很多优秀的特性,如零待机功耗,独特的单线接口仅需一个端口引脚进行通讯,报警搜索命令识别并标志超过程序限定温度(温度报警条件)的器件。3:/article/83/116/2016/20160104397743.html电源模块 因为用的是MSP430的LAUNCHPAD/try.html开发板,故3,5V供电电压不用单独制作。只需产生运放需要要的12V电压,本设计依赖34063的/?u=999芯片的升压,由5V升到12V。4:液晶显示模块此设计也是经典之举,尽管抬高了此作品的造价,因430总共只有10个可操控IO口,而一般的显示模块都得用8个左右,而用12864的串行模式,同时运用MSP430的SPI/zhuti_wireless_1.html通信,既方便又高效的完成了液晶显示的操作。同时采用5分钟定时息屏操作,从根本上解决了低功耗的问题,环保,节约。关于12864这里不再赘述。4:按键模块 /forum.php?mod=attachmentaid=OTg0NzJ8NDRjODA1ZmN8MTUxMTE2OTM3MXwwfDI0MjM2Nw%3D%3Dnothu

文档评论(0)

178****9325 +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档